Accessible homes: Independent living

Often people are unaware of the adaptations that are available to help them, or their family members live independently for as long as possible. Or that often there is financial support to help them achieve this.
Natasha's experience working in Health & Social Care has given Fenestra Glazing a great opportunity to think about the needs of people with disabilities and how we can help them address these needs within their homes.
We can help to direct you to sources of funding to pay either partially or in full for adaptations or technologies that can help you. Whether it be for larger pieces of work like widening door ways and installing wheelchair accessible doors. High tech solutions such as iPhone operated door locks or simple adaptations like window restrictors to prevent the risk of falls.

Competent Installation Teams

Make sure you employ competent, qualified tradesmen. Unfortunately the double glazing industry has received some bad press, with "cowboy" builders and installers causing damage to property and using some very unsafe practices. But the industry is working hard to make these stories ones of the past. To avoid these pitfalls, ensure you employ installers who are part of an easily recognised national registration body.
